WebSep 23, 2012 · Instructions. Add the warm water to the container. You can use any small container—just make sure it is clean. Drop the baking soda into the warm water and mix until dissolved. Place the dropper into the water and withdraw approximately 4 drops of solution. Place into each ear (without pushing the dropper too far into the ear).
